  • 摘要:The objective of this research is to study the fotodegradation of phenol bytitanium dioxide and titanium silicate mesoporous-mesostructureaccelerated by hydrogen peroxide (H2O2). Photodegradations were carriedout in stirred slurries of mesoporous-mesostructure titanium dioxide andtitanium silicate: 0.15 g TiO2-layered macrostructure, 0.35 g TiO2/MCM-41and 0,5 g Ti-MCM-41 in deionized water respectively. Phenol solution (0,5g/L) was illuminated by 160 W from mercury lamp at times various: 20, 40,60 and 80 minute. The results show that TiO2-layered mesostructurefollowed by TiO2/MCM-41 are the two most active photocatalyst, while Ti-MCM-41 is not active photocatalyst. Organic substances produced fromphenol fotodegradation include phenol → p-benzoquinon, hydroquinon →catecol → maleic acid → acetic acid and formic acid → water and carbondioxide.
